What SEO really means for a small business
SEO means making your website show up on Google when people search for your service. That is it. No more, no less.
If you run a dental clinic in Guwahati and someone searches "best dentist near me" or "root canal in Guwahati", you want your website or Google Business Profile to come up in the first 3 results. That is SEO.
For a small business, SEO means three things working together:
- On-page SEO — your website tells Google clearly what you do and for which city.
- Technical SEO — your website loads fast, works on mobile and does not have broken links.
- Local SEO — your Google Business Profile is complete, your reviews are real, and you appear in Google Maps when someone nearby searches.
That is the whole game for most small businesses. You do not need to rank nationally. You do not need 10,000 backlinks. You need to be found by the 200 people in your city who are searching for your service this month.
Why SEO matters more than ads for small businesses
Let us do simple math. Say you spend ₹20,000 on Google Ads this month. You get 50 leads. Next month you stop paying. You get 0 leads. The tap turned off.
Now imagine you spend ₹20,000 on SEO this month. Month 1 you get 2 leads. Month 3 you get 10 leads. Month 6 you get 25 leads. Month 12 you get 40 to 60 leads. And if you stop paying, those leads do not disappear overnight — they slowly reduce over 2 to 3 months.
SEO builds an asset. Google Ads is like renting. Every rupee on ads disappears when you stop paying. Every rupee on real SEO keeps working for months.
Also, people trust organic results more than ads. When a customer sees the "Sponsored" label, they know you paid to be there. When you show up organically, you look like a trusted option.

5 SEO tasks you can do yourself today
Before paying any agency, do these 5 things. They take 1 to 2 hours each. They are free. They move the needle for most Indian small businesses.
1. Claim and complete your Google Business Profile
Go to google.com/business. Claim your listing. Fill every field. Add 15 to 20 photos. Set correct hours. Add all service categories. This one step alone can bring you 10 to 30 calls a month if done right. Most businesses fill 40 percent and wonder why no one calls.
2. Ask your happiest customers for Google reviews
Send a WhatsApp message to your last 20 happy customers. Share your Google review link. Ask for 2 sentences. Within 2 weeks, you should have 10 to 15 new real reviews. Google ranks businesses with 20+ real reviews higher in Maps. This is the single highest-ROI local SEO task.
3. Fix your website page titles
Every page on your site needs a clear title. "Home Page" is not a title. "Best Dentist in Guwahati | Dr. Das Clinic - Zoo Road" is a title. Each page title should have your main keyword and your city. Takes 30 minutes for most small sites.
4. Test your website speed
Go to pagespeed.web.dev. Enter your website URL. If the mobile score is below 60, you have a problem. Slow sites lose customers and Google ranks them lower. Most fixes are image compression and reducing plugins. Your web developer can fix this in 2 to 3 hours.
5. Write one 800-word page about your top service
Pick your highest-margin service. Write a dedicated page about it. Include who it is for, how it works, what it costs, common questions and customer stories. 800 words minimum. This is the page that will rank and bring you customers for years.
Do these 5 and see what happens in 60 days. If you see improvement, continue. If you want a pro to take over, read the next section.
When should a small business hire an SEO expert?
Hire an SEO expert when one of these is true:
- You have already done the 5 free tasks above and want the next level.
- Your traffic has dropped suddenly. Google may have penalised you.
- You are in a competitive industry (law, medical, real estate, finance) where SEO needs expert handling.
- You have a Shopify or WooCommerce store and want it to rank.
- Your time is worth more than ₹500 an hour and doing it yourself costs you business.
